I got an account with Experian to monitor my credit like a responsible adult. HUGE mistake. They started charging me for my "free" account. I tried to call them to terminate my account, and the first few times I called they wouldn't let me, saying my account was "already free" - a major lie as they were charging me for it. I wasted several hours on the phone and finally got them to cancel my account, or so  I thought. Just recieved a letter in the mail frommy bank saying Experian was still trying to charge me for my now non-existant account. Thankfully I canceled my credit card as I saw this coming. Experian will lie left and right to get money from you. Never trust them with any of your information.
